Transaction ced838892bcc974cdb26b7da02cf09f0f5a5112734b91a5614c9e8217566eddd

239 Input
2 Outputs
  • ced838892bcc974cdb26b7da02cf09f0f5a5112734b91a5614c9e8217566eddd:0
  • value  781336257
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• ced838892bcc974cdb26b7da02cf09f0f5a5112734b91a5614c9e8217566eddd:1
  • value  997970
    address  3KQ7LdQRthxdGZqtEsuuSDcy6Jx9mPsZDC